Interest Expense is the amount reported by a company or individual as an expense for borrowed money. Lloyds Luxuries's interest expense for the six months ended in Mar. 2026 was ₹ 0.0 Mil. Its interest expense for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 was ₹0.0 Mil.

Interest Coverage is a ratio that determines how easily a company can pay interest expenses on outstanding debt. It is calculated by dividing a company's Operating Income(EBIT) by its Interest Expense. Lloyds Luxuries's Operating Income for the six months ended in Mar. 2026 was ₹ -2.8 Mil. Lloyds Luxuries's Interest Expense for the six months ended in Mar. 2026 was ₹ 0.0 Mil. Lloyds Luxuries has no long-term debt (1). The higher the ratio, the stronger the company's financial strength is. Lloyds Luxuries Business Description

Address Pandurang Budhkar Marg, Delisle Road, B2, Unit No. 3, 2nd Floor, Madhu Estate, Lower Parel, Mumbai, MH, IND, 400013
Lloyds Luxuries Ltd is an organized player of salon services and beauty products in India, focused on sale & services of men's and women's groom care products. The company owns an exclusive franchisee of Truefitt & Hill, which is an international brand offering a wide range of beauty products and salon services for men through luxury barbershops operating across many countries.
